Search Methods for Tile Sets in Patterned DNA Self-Assembly (1412.7219v1)

Published 23 Dec 2014 in cs.ET and cs.DS

Abstract: The Pattern self-Assembly Tile set Synthesis (PATS) problem, which arises in the theory of structured DNA self-assembly, is to determine a set of coloured tiles that, starting from a bordering seed structure, self-assembles to a given rectangular colour pattern. The task of finding minimum-size tile sets is known to be NP-hard. We explore several complete and incomplete search techniques for finding minimal, or at least small, tile sets and also assess the reliability of the solutions obtained according to the kinetic Tile Assembly Model.
